1. Core Trading Strategy
1.1 Entry Methods (3 Types)
A. Engulfing Pattern (Enhanced)
- Classic bullish engulfing candle detection
- Enhancement: Filtered for noise reduction
- Entry timing: After engulfing close confirmation
- Logic:
Close[0] > Open[1] AND Close[0] > High[1] AND Open[0] < Close[1]
B. Breakout-Retest Strategy
- Price breaks above key level
- Pullback to retest level as support
- Entry on bounce confirmation
- Anti-spam mechanics: Minimum distance between trades
C. Trend Filter Confirmation
- ALL entries require multi-timeframe trend confirmation
- Uses 200-period EMA on M15, H1, and H4
- Trade only when:
Close > EMA200(M15) AND Close > EMA200(H1) AND Close > EMA200(H4) - This is critical: No counter-trend trades!

2. Risk Management Framework
2.1 Lot Sizing (2 Methods)
Method 1: Fixed Lot
- Simple approach: e.g., 0.01 lot per trade
- Pros: Predictable, easy to manage
- Cons: Doesn't adapt to account growth
Method 2: Risk-Based Percentage
- Formula:
Lot = (AccountBalance * RiskPercent / 100) / (StopLossPips * PipValue) - Auto-adjusts to:
- Account balance
- Stop loss distance
- Market volatility (via ATR proxy)
- Recommended: 1-2% risk per trade
2.2 Stop Loss Logic
Dynamic Trend-Based SL:
- Initial SL: Based on recent swing low (for BUY) + buffer
- Never moves backward — Key rule!
- Only moves forward to protect profit (trailing effect)
- Logic:
NewSL = max(CurrentSL, CurrentPrice - TrailingDistance)
Stop Loss Distance:
- Adaptive to volatility (likely ATR-based, though not explicitly stated)
- Minimum distance to avoid stop hunting
- Typical range: 20-50 pips for Gold (on M1)

4. Technical Implementation Details
4.1 EMA Filter Implementation
200-period EMA on M15, H1, H4:
bool IsTrendBullish() {
double ema200_M15 = iMA(XAUUSD, PERIOD_M15, 200, 0, MODE_EMA, PRICE_CLOSE);
double ema200_H1 = iMA(XAUUSD, PERIOD_H1, 200, 0, MODE_EMA, PRICE_CLOSE);
double ema200_H4 = iMA(XAUUSD, PERIOD_H4, 200, 0, MODE_EMA, PRICE_CLOSE);
double currentPrice = SymbolInfoDouble(XAUUSD, SYMBOL_BID);
return (currentPrice > ema200_M15 &&
currentPrice > ema200_H1 &&
currentPrice > ema200_H4);
}
Why 200 EMA?
- Industry standard for long-term trend (40 hours on M15, 200 hours on H1)
- Strong support/resistance level
- Institutions watch this level
4.2 Engulfing Pattern Detection
bool IsBullishEngulfing() {
double open1 = iOpen(XAUUSD, PERIOD_M1, 1);
double close1 = iClose(XAUUSD, PERIOD_M1, 1);
double high1 = iHigh(XAUUSD, PERIOD_M1, 1);
double low1 = iLow(XAUUSD, PERIOD_M1, 1);
double open0 = iOpen(XAUUSD, PERIOD_M1, 0);
double close0 = iClose(XAUUSD, PERIOD_M1, 0);
// Classic engulfing: current bullish body engulfs previous bearish body
bool isEngulfing = (close1 < open1) && // Previous candle bearish
(close0 > open0) && // Current candle bullish
(open0 < close1) && // Opens below previous close
(close0 > open1); // Closes above previous open
// Enhanced filter (likely):
double bodySize = close0 - open0;
double avgBody = iATR(XAUUSD, PERIOD_M1, 14) * 0.5; // Half ATR as threshold
return isEngulfing && (bodySize > avgBody); // Minimum body size
}
4.3 Breakout-Retest Logic
// Simplified pseudo-code
bool IsBreakoutRetest() {
// 1. Identify recent high (resistance level)
double recentHigh = iHigh(XAUUSD, PERIOD_M1, iHighest(XAUUSD, PERIOD_M1, MODE_HIGH, 20, 1));
// 2. Check if price broke above
bool brokeAbove = (iClose(XAUUSD, PERIOD_M1, 1) > recentHigh);
// 3. Check if price pulled back to retest
double currentPrice = SymbolInfoDouble(XAUUSD, SYMBOL_BID);
bool pullback = (currentPrice <= recentHigh + tolerancePips * Point);
// 4. Check if price bouncing back up
bool bouncing = (iClose(XAUUSD, PERIOD_M1, 0) > iClose(XAUUSD, PERIOD_M1, 1));
return brokeAbove && pullback && bouncing;
}
